What companies run services between Warwick, Warwickshire, England and Legoland Windsor, England?

You can take a train from Warwick to Legoland Windsor via Leamington Spa, Reading, Slough, Windsor & Eton Central, Parish Church, and Legoland Park & Ride in around 2h 42m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Warwick Castle to Legoland Windsor via Transport Museum, Pool Meadow Bus Station, Heathrow Central Bus Station, Wellington Street Stop H, and Legoland Park & Ride in around 4h 31m.
